Output 34d13d6b83b80fc39de703808a5303b30bc6db640bbe008da626ead95e037c68:6

value
14976053586
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39ea18e0a8a83ff356bbce0b9a0aca014414a61e OP_EQUALVERIFY OP_CHECKSIG
address
DARKVYqxcakfbwymbMFXbWTThLypmoZDcM
transaction
34d13d6b83b80fc39de703808a5303b30bc6db640bbe008da626ead95e037c68